(PC) Martin v. State of California et al
Plaintiff: Amaya Martin
Defendant: California Department of Correction and Rehabilitation, Davis, California Institution for Women and State of California
Case Number: 2:2024cv03380
Filed: December 4, 2024
Court: U.S. District Court for the Eastern District of California
Presiding Judge: Troy L Nunley
Referring Judge: Jeremy D Peterson
Nature of Suit: Prisoner: Civil Rights
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1441 Petition for Removal- Civil Rights Act
Jury Demanded By: Both

Date Filed Document Text
January 29, 2025 Opinion or Order Filing 9 ORDER and FINDINGS and RECOMMENDATIONS signed by Magistrate Judge Jeremy D. Peterson on 01/28/2025 DENYING Defendants' #3 Request for Clarification as moot and DIRECTING the Clerk to randomly assign a district judge to this action. Chief District Judge Troy L. Nunley and Magistrate Judge Jeremy D. Peterson assigned for all further proceedings. It is RECOMMENDED that Plaintiff's #7 Motion to Remand be granted, this case be remanded to the Superior Court of the State of California in and for the County of Sacramento, and the Clerk be directed to send a certified copy of this order to the Superior Court of California in and for the County of Sacramento and to close the case. Referred to Judge Troy L. Nunley. Objections due within 14 days after being served with these findings and recommendations. New Case Number: 2:24-cv-3380 TLN JDP (PC). (Deputy Clerk KS)
January 10, 2025 Opinion or Order Filing 8 STATEMENT of NON-OPPOSITION by California Department of Correction and Rehabilitation, State of California to #7 Motion to Remand. Attorney Glantz, Zachary added. (Glantz, Zachary)
January 2, 2025 Opinion or Order Filing 7 MOTION to REMAND by Amaya Martin. Motion Hearing set for 2/13/2025 at 10:00 AM in Courtroom 9 (JDP) before Magistrate Judge Jeremy D. Peterson. (Attachments: #1 Proposed Order)(Brown, Laura)
December 27, 2024 Opinion or Order Filing 6 FIRST AMENDED COMPLAINT against California Department of Correction and Rehabilitation, Davis, State of California by Amaya Martin. (Wagner, Nicholas)
December 16, 2024 Opinion or Order Filing 5 JURY DEMAND by Amaya Martin. (Wagner, Nicholas)
December 11, 2024 Opinion or Order Filing 4 NOTICE of APPEARANCE by Zachary Glantz on behalf of California Department of Correction and Rehabilitation. Attorney Glantz, Zachary added. (Glantz, Zachary)
December 10, 2024 Opinion or Order Filing 3 REQUEST for Clarification Regarding Screening of Complaint and for Extension of Time to Respond to Complaint by California Department of Correction and Rehabilitation, State of California. (Attachments: #1 Proposed Order, #2 Proof of Service) (Mark, Arthur)
December 4, 2024 Opinion or Order Filing 2 PRISONER NEW CASE DOCUMENTS and ORDER RE CONSENT ISSUED. Consent or Decline due by 1/6/2025. (Attachments: #1 Litigant Letter) (Becknal, R.)
December 4, 2024 Opinion or Order Filing 1 NOTICE of REMOVAL from Sacramento County Superior Court, case number 24CV018187 by B. Freriks . (Filing fee $ 405, receipt number ACAEDC-11905040) (Attachments: #1 Civil Cover Sheet) (Mark, Arthur)
